The Ugly Stik GX2 Youth Spinning Rod and Reel Combo is designed with young anglers in mind, offering a great balance of durability, ease of use, and sensitivity. The rod is 5 feet 6 inches long, a good size for kids to handle comfortably without being too heavy or unwieldy. Made from a blend of graphite and fiberglass (called Ugly Tech construction), it stays tough while remaining flexible enough to feel bites on the line. The medium power rating means it can handle a decent range of fish without being too stiff for beginners. The clear tip adds extra sensitivity, which is helpful for learning when fish are nibbling.

The included 30-size spinning reel is lightweight, with a smooth retrieve and good line capacity, making it simple for kids to cast and reel in. It’s also built to resist corrosion, so it can last through many fishing trips. The two-piece design makes it easy to transport and store. On the downside, while the rod is versatile for many freshwater species like bass, it might not be ideal for larger fish or saltwater use due to its medium power and line limits (6-12 pounds). Some users might find the reel's gear ratio a bit slow for faster retrieves.

With solid build quality and a 10-year warranty, this combo provides confidence for parents looking to invest in a beginner-friendly fishing setup that can grow with their child. This combination is a strong choice for kids starting out or for those who want a reliable, durable rod and reel made specifically for youth anglers.

The Zebco 33 Spincast Reel and Fishing Rod Combos (2-Pack) offer a great entry-level fishing set, especially suited for kids or beginners. Each rod is 5 feet 6 inches long, which is a manageable length for younger anglers, allowing better control without being too bulky. Made from durable fiberglass, these rods can handle a variety of fish thanks to their moderate action and medium power, making them versatile for catching everything from small panfish to bass. The EVA handle ensures a comfortable grip during long fishing sessions, which helps keep young hands happy.

The included spincast reels are easy to use and come pre-spooled with 10-pound line, which is strong enough for most freshwater fishing. They feature a smooth 4.1:1 gear ratio and QuickSet anti-reverse, helping with smooth casting and solid hook sets. Also, the reels are ambidextrous, meaning they can be used by right- or left-handed anglers.

While the rods are sturdy and reliable, the combo’s moderate power and action might not be ideal for very large or heavy fish. The two-pack comes in pink and black colors, which adds a fun variety but might not suit everyone's taste. The Zebco 33 combo covers the basics well, making it a comfortable and user-friendly choice for kids or beginners ready to enjoy fishing without complicated gear.

The ODDSPRO Kids Fishing Pole is designed as a comprehensive starter kit for kids aged 3 to 15 who are interested in fishing. This fishing rod and reel combo comes with a tackle box filled with various fishing lures and accessories, making it versatile for different fishing scenarios. The collapsible design and included travel bag make it easily portable, appealing for family outings or vacations. The choice of carbon fiber for the rod material not only ensures lightweight handling but also adds durability, which is excellent for children learning the ropes of fishing.

With rod lengths available at 1.2, 1.5, and 1.8 meters, it caters to a broad age range and varying heights of young anglers. The medium power rating of the rod, paired with a spincast reel, is a suitable combination that balances ease of use with enough strength to handle a typical fishing experience for kids. The inclusion of a soft casting plug is a thoughtful addition, allowing kids to practice casting safely.

There are some considerations to note. The kit uses a monofilament line with a line capacity of 6 pounds, which might limit the size of fish that can be comfortably caught. While the spincast reel is user-friendly, it's not as durable as higher-end reels, meaning it might require careful handling. Additionally, the rod handle is designed for right-hand orientation, which could be a limitation for left-handed users. The ODDSPRO Kids Fishing Pole's simplicity and complete package make it a great gift option and a practical choice for beginners. It provides an engaging way for kids to learn and enjoy fishing, although more seasoned young anglers might eventually seek more advanced equipment as they grow more experienced.

Buying Guide for the Best Kids Fishing Rods

Choosing the right fishing rod for kids can make a big difference in their fishing experience. The right rod will be easy for them to handle, durable enough to withstand some rough use, and suitable for the type of fishing they will be doing. Here are some key specifications to consider when selecting a fishing rod for kids, along with explanations to help you make the best choice.
LengthThe length of a fishing rod is important because it affects how far and accurately a child can cast. Shorter rods, typically between 3 to 4 feet, are easier for young children to handle and are great for fishing in small ponds or streams. Medium-length rods, around 5 to 6 feet, offer a balance of casting distance and control, making them suitable for older kids or those fishing in larger bodies of water. Longer rods, over 6 feet, are generally better for more experienced young anglers who need to cast further distances. Choose a length that matches your child's age, strength, and the type of fishing they will be doing.
MaterialFishing rods are made from various materials, each with its own benefits. Fiberglass rods are durable and can withstand rough handling, making them a good choice for younger children. They are also more affordable. Graphite rods are lighter and more sensitive, which can help older kids feel bites more easily, but they can be more fragile. Composite rods combine both materials, offering a balance of durability and sensitivity. Consider your child's age and experience level when choosing the material.
PowerPower refers to the rod's ability to handle different weights of fish. Ultra-light and light power rods are suitable for catching small fish like panfish or trout, making them ideal for young children. Medium power rods can handle a wider range of fish sizes, which is good for older kids who might encounter larger fish. Heavy power rods are designed for big fish and are generally not necessary for most kids. Choose a power level that matches the type of fish your child will be targeting.
ActionAction describes how much and where a rod bends when pressure is applied. Fast action rods bend mostly at the tip and are good for quick hook sets, making them suitable for older kids with some fishing experience. Medium action rods bend more towards the middle, offering a balance of sensitivity and strength, which is great for a variety of fishing situations. Slow action rods bend throughout the entire length, providing more flexibility and making them easier for young children to handle. Consider your child's skill level and the type of fishing they will be doing when choosing the action.
HandleThe handle of a fishing rod should be comfortable and easy for a child to grip. Handles are typically made from materials like cork or EVA foam. Cork handles are lightweight and provide a good grip, but they can be more expensive. EVA foam handles are durable and comfortable, making them a good choice for kids. The length of the handle is also important; shorter handles are easier for small hands to manage, while longer handles can provide more leverage for older kids. Choose a handle that feels comfortable for your child to hold and use.
Reel TypeThe type of reel that comes with the rod can affect how easy it is for a child to use. Spincast reels are the easiest for kids to use because they have a simple push-button mechanism. They are great for beginners. Spinning reels require a bit more skill to operate but offer better casting distance and accuracy, making them suitable for older kids with some fishing experience. Baitcasting reels are generally not recommended for children due to their complexity. Choose a reel type that matches your child's skill level and experience.
